Interpreting the Vandalism Maps

When looking at the vandalism map for Shortville, remember that the rate of vandalism per resident may appear inflated when people visit the area during the day, but do not live there. For example, there are few retail establishments in the city. Many crimes are committed in retail areas in blocks where few people live. Red areas on the vandalism rate map do not always indicate danger for Shortville residents who live there.

More issues arise with places like airports, parks, and schools. Major airports, of which Shortville has 0, always look like high-crime locations due to the large number of people and the low population nearby. Parks and designated recreational areas, of which Shortville has 0, have the same problem. Of Shortville’s 1,097 residents, few live near recreational areas. Because many people visit, crime rates may appear higher even for safe parks. Ultimately crime happens where people are, whether they live there or not. Before writing off an area as unsafe, look at both the crime rate and total crime maps, then consider nearby destinations that people may be visiting.
